Model & Market Context

This airframe, registered as N658QX, is an Embraer-built regional jet identified as the Embraer ERJ-175LR (ERJ-170-200LR) and manufactured by Embraer S.A. in 2023. The airframe carries manufacturer serial number 17000945 and appears on U.S. registry as US-registered. Ownership records list the aircraft to HORIZON AIR INDUSTRIES INC, a corporation based in Seattle, WA, US, which is the current registered owner of record. Detailed valuation or condition assessments for this specific airframe are not published; ownership and registry entries reflect corporate custody rather than detailed operational history.

The reported cabin configuration for this airframe is C12Y64 (reported / operator variations possible), indicating a 12-seat business/first class and 64-seat economy arrangement subject to operator-specific outfitting. With a maximum cruise of 480 kts and a range of 2,200 nm, N658QX is well suited to regional and short transcontinental sectors typical of U.S. west-coast and intra-continental services operated from its corporate base in Seattle, WA, US. The twin GE CF34-8E5 turbofan installation supports typical regional jet mission profiles emphasizing frequent short- to medium-haul rotations; specific avionics fit and unique amenity details for this hull are not published.

The Embraer ERJ-175LR belongs to the ERJ-170/175 family targeted at the high-density regional jet market, combining a maximum operating ceiling of 41,000 ft, a cruise speed near 480 kts, and seating in the upper 70s to high 80s for this variant. With 88 seats and the LR range extension to 2,200 nm, the type competes in the regional sector against other stretched regional jets and small narrowbodies for airline and corporate-regional operators. Market considerations for this airframe include demand for short- to medium-range regional capacity, lifecycle maintenance on CF34-series engines, and resale dynamics tied to operator configuration variability (as reflected in the reported C12Y64 cabin).
